What Does a Motor Vehicle Accident Attorney Do?
An automobile accident attorney specializes in representing customers who have been associated with car, truck, bike, or any other kind of vehicle crash. Their main function is to make sure that victims get the compensation they should have for their injuries and damages. Here are some of the services they generally supply:

The decision to employ an attorney after a motor vehicle accident can frequently influence the outcome of a victim's case considerably. Here are several factors why employing the assistance of a certified attorney is crucial:

Expertise in Personal Injury Law: Motor vehicle accident lawyers are fluent in the laws controling injury claims and can effectively navigate the Legal Representation For Accidents system.

Maximized Compensation: Attorneys understand the different types of compensation offered, including medical costs, lost incomes, pain and suffering, and property damage, and strive to ensure customers receive the complete quantity they are entitled to.

Neutrality: After an accident, feelings can run high. Lawyers supply an objective point of view and can help clients make choices that are in their best interests.

Negotiation Skills: Insurance companies frequently try to minimize payouts. Attorneys have the settlement abilities and experience to deal with these methods effectively.

Resources: Attorneys have access to resources such as detectives and expert witnesses that can strengthen a case.

Contingency Fees: Many motor vehicle accident attorneys deal with a contingency charge basis, indicating they just make money if the customer wins a settlement. This allows clients to pursue legal action without considerable in advance costs.

For how long do I have to sue after an accident?
The majority of states have a statute of restrictions varying from one to 3 years for accident claims. However, it's best to consult an attorney as quickly as possible to maintain your rights.
2. How is compensation identified?
Compensation is normally based upon factors such as medical expenditures, lost salaries, pain and suffering, and home damage. An attorney can assist calculate these quantities properly.
3. What if I was partially at fault for the accident?
Many states run under comparative neglect laws, meaning you can still recover compensation even if you were partially at fault. Nevertheless, your settlement might be decreased based on your degree of fault.
4. Will my case go to trial?
Not all cases go to trial; numerous are settled through negotiation. Nevertheless, your attorney will get ready for litigation as a possibility to ensure the best outcome for your case.
5. What is the average settlement for a motor vehicle accident?
Settlements differ commonly based on the specifics of each case. Factors such as the degree of injuries, insurance coverage, and liability all play functions in determining the last quantity.
